What is Max View Distance?

Max View Distance tells your server exactly how many chunks to send to your game client at any given time. By default, this value is set to 12, which provides a solid balance of visibility and stability for most players.
 
Increasing this value lets you see structures and unique biomes from much farther away, while lowering it can improve frame rates if you’re experiencing performance issues.
 

Performance and RAM

⚠️ High view distances come with a heavy cost to your server resources.
Every extra chunk you load puts a significant strain on your RAM and CPU. If you start noticing heavy lag or your server begins to crash unexpectedly, you likely need more memory to handle the visual load. Optimizing your server settings, such as fine-tuning view distance and monitoring resource usage, can help maintain stable performance before scaling your hardware.

How to Change Hytale Max View Distance

Adjusting this setting only takes a few seconds inside your Apex server panel. 👇

  1. Navigate to Server Configuration > Config Files on the left side of your panel.
    Change the Max View Distance on a Hytale Server - Open Config Files Tab
  2. Select Hytale Server Settings.
    Change the Max View Distance on a Hytale Server - Select Hytale Server Settings
  3. Scroll to the bottom to find the Max View Distance option and change the number from 12 (default) to your new desired value.
    Change the Max View Distance on a Hytale Server - Edit Max View Distance
  4. Save the changes to apply them to your server.

Hytale PerformanceSaver Plugin

We have included the Hytale PerformanceSaver Plugin to help keep your world stable during intense gameplay. This tool is designed to dynamically adjust your view distance in real-time if it detects that the server is beginning to struggle.
 
By scaling the distance down during high-traffic moments, it prevents lag spikes before they can ruin your adventure. This ensures that your players always have a responsive experience, even when the server is under heavy load.
